Sump Pump Overflow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Large-scale water damage (over 100 square feet) No Yes Too much water to handle safely and efficiently.
Hidden water damage behind walls or under floors No Yes Hidden damage can lead to costly repairs and further damage.
Water damage in areas with poor ventilation (e.g., basements) No Yes Poor ventilation increases health risks and mold growth.
Water damage in areas with high humidity or moisture No Yes High humidity and moisture can lead to mold growth and further damage.
Water damage in areas with valuable or sensitive items (e.g., electronics, artwork) No Yes Valuable items need specialized care and handling.
Water damage in areas with structural concerns (e.g., foundation issues) No Yes Structural concerns need expert attention to prevent further damage.

Sump Pump Overflow Water Removal Cost in Union, IA

The cost of Sump Pump Overflow Water Remov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Union, IA. These estimates are based on industry standards and real-world costs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ed
Cleaning and disinfection $100 – $1,000 Area size, equipment needed, type of cleaning products used
Restoration and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000+ Area size, severity of damage, type of materials used
IICRC certification and quality control $500 – $2,000 Area size, equipment needed, level of certification
Emergency response and equipment rental $100 – $1,000 Area size, equipment needed, response time
Insurance claims and documentation $100 – $1,000 Area size, type of damage, insurance coverage
